Understanding the 75% Attendance Rule


Many academic institutions enforce a 75% rule policy, which means that a learner must maintain 75% presence to retain internal marks and participation rights. This standard ensures consistent participation throughout the semester. Missing this mark could result in exam restrictions.

With the help of a 75% attendance calculator, students can easily determine how many classes they need to attend. By entering basic attendance data, the calculator shows your attendance ratio and helps you plan improvements if you’re under 75%.

How the Attendance Calculator Works


A digital attendance calculator works on a simple mathematical formula:
Attendance percentage = (Number of classes attended ÷ Total classes conducted) × 100.

By entering these figures, you can get an immediate result. Moreover, some calculators include forecasting options based on scheduled sessions and current data. This aids in maintaining balance and ensures steady compliance with attendance norms.

Making the Most of the 75 Percent Calculator


To get the best results, enter correct data in the attendance threshold tool. Input your current and future attendance plans. The tool will show your ratio and reveal how many classes are needed to reach 75% attendance. 75% attendance calculator

For example, if your record shows 60/80 attendance, your attendance is 75%. But if the attended count is 55, the calculator helps estimate required attendance to achieve 75%. This advance planning prevents surprises before exams.
